The Rise of the Squinting Meme
Understanding the Context
The meme typically features either a person or animated character squinting intensely—often with exaggerated eyelashes, furrowed brows, or clenched jaws—paired with a caption expressing escalating confusion, disappointment, or absurd exasperation. What started as a relatable joke among internet users ballooned into a worldwide sensation due to its perfect blend of humor and shared experience. The visual simplicity allowed users to instantly project their own struggles—whether from confusing meme formats, bizarre news, or arguments with roommates—onto the expression.
Why Did It Go Viral?
The viral spike of the squinting meme stems from relatability. In an age full of information overload, people feel the squint—not literally, but mentally—as a sign of overwhelmed processing. The meme captures that universal eye roll and inner scream of embarrassment or frustration. Psychology highlights that eye movement—especially squinting—signals cognitive strain, making the image instantly recognizable. Combined with short-form, punchy captions, it’s the perfect recipe for shareability.
Social media algorithms amplified the trend, as users liked, remixed, and participated by posting their squint reactions to everyday absurdities—from confusing meme lingo to awkward Tinder moments. The phrase “Why are you still trying not to scream?” became a rallying cry, blending dark humor with collective catharsis.
